I have been looking around for ages to try to find a simple and easy method of protecting the foot and blade of my hand planes. I saw the thing that I was looking for in the Axminster catalog, small rare earth magnets. So I lashed out a couple of ££ and got 10. I then cut some white faced hardboard I had for a fibre glassing job and finished up with these.

DSC07958.jpg


DSC07959.jpg


The side pieces protect the sides of the foot. There's also a slight slot cut into the base so the blade has somewhere to sit unhindered. They work really well.
